  • Weird History Food is giving you a warm bowl of nostalgia with the History of Campbell's Soup. Probably one of the most recognizable food designs, the Campbell's Soup can is both part of modern pop culture and in just about every American pantry. But where did the company get its start? And how has Campbell's stayed a relevant brand for over 150 years? Get some crackers and pepper ready, we're going soup to nuts on Campbell's.

    0:16: 🍲 The history of Campbell's Soup, from its humble beginnings as a fruit canning firm to becoming a household name.
    3:01: 🥫 The video discusses the history of the Joseph Campbell Preserve Company and its founder.
    5:57: 🍲 Campbell's condensed soup lineup changed its design to red and white after Herberton Williams was inspired by Cornell's uniforms.
    11:38: 🥫 Campbell's Soup Company decentralized operations, closed plants, reduced sodium content, and faced challenges with flavor.
